Wood gutter repair services involve fixing damaged or compromised sections of a property's rainwater drainage system. This work typically includes replacing broken or rusted gutter sections, re-securing loose hangers, sealing leaks, and addressing sagging or misaligned gutters.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ing gutters and perform repairs to restore their proper function, helping to prevent water from spilling over the sides or seeping into the building’s structure.
These services are essential for resolving common issues such as clogged or overflowing gutters, leaks, and sagging that can lead to water damage. When gutters are damaged or improperly installed, they may fail to channel rainwater away from the foundation, resulting in basement flooding, erosion, or damage to siding and landscaping. Repairing gutters promptly ensures that rainwater is effectively directed away from the property, reducing the risk of costly repairs and structural problems.

Cost Range for Gutter Repair - Typical costs for wood gutter repair services can vary between $200 and $600 depending on the extent of damage and length of gutters involved. For example, minor patch repairs may cost around $200, while replacing sections could reach up to $600 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ense depends on factors such as gutter size, accessibility, and whether additional repairs are needed. Unusual or hard-to-reach locations may increase the overall cost for local service providers.
Average Service Charges - On average, homeowners in Crownsville, MD, can expect to pay approximately $300 to $450 for standard wood gutter repairs. Larger or more complex projects t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Expenses - Costs may increase if repairs involve replacing damaged fascia or soffits, with prices potentially adding $100 to $300 extra. Contractors typically provide estimates based on the specific scope of work required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that wood gutters need repair? Visible rot, sagging sections, cracked or split wood, and water leaks are typical indicators that wood gutters may require repair or replacement.
Can wood gutters be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many minor damages or rotted sections can be repaired by a professional, but extensive deterioration might necessitate full replacement.
How long does wood gutter rep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
Are there maintenance tips to prevent future wood gutter damage? Regular inspections, cleaning out debris, and addressing minor issues promptly can help extend the lifespan of wood gutters.
